Bench Grinder: Won't Turn on

If your bench grinder won't turn on, check the following parts: the capacitor, switch, cord, and motor. Use our troubleshooting guide to help determine which part is causing the issue. In most cases this can be a quick and easy fix. Check your owner's manual for complete detailed instructions for your particular model.

Motors

If the motor is shorted out in your bench grinder, it can trip the circuit breaker of the power source and you will have trouble turning it on. The motor, which is connected to the capacitor, should be replaced to fix this problem.

Power Cords

The cord on your bench grinder works as a source of power and if it is broken or burned out, then your grinder will not turn on. To replace the cord, first remove the cord clamp by removing the retaining screws. Next, lift the cord and switch the assembly out of the handle and disconnect the cord from the switch by removing the screws. Once you pull the cord from the grinder, you are ready to install a new cord. Tip: make sure to trim the new cord wires before reassembling your grinder.

Switches

If the switch is broken, it will not allow you to turn on the appliance. In this case, you will need to replace it with a new switch. To access the switch and replace it, remove parts such as the handles and guards. To remove switch, place it in the off position and push forward on the switch lever. Now you are ready to install a new switch. For further instructions, follow the manual provided by the manufacturer and remember to unplug the appliance from the power source for safety.

Capacitor

If your bench grinder will not turn on, check the capacitor, which activates the motor to run with the energy it has stored in. If there is a failure or it is defective, replace the capacitor by removing the wires with a pair of pliers and reconnecting them to the new capacitor. Remember to unplug the grinder from your power source before installing this part.
